The Foundation ’ s initial focus on new buildings means we have award-winning spaces across the campus . These world-class buildings enable students to learn and thrive in an inspiring environment . Our most recent project , New House , the boarding house on the old Lambardes site , was completed earlier in the year and the first cohort of students are settled in . The house completes a closely connected boarding community alongside Aisher House , Park Grange and the IC . It also concludes the delivery of the school ’ s masterplan , which began with the opening of the Sennocke Centre in 2005 .
Alongside these capital projects , we have provided financial assistance for students who would otherwise not be able to experience a pioneering Sevenoaks education : a tradition linked to the very reason William Sevenoke established the school nearly 600 years ago , and maintained throughout the centuries . As we look to the future , the focus of the Foundation will be to deepen support for financial assistance through establishing a permanent endowment for the school , as part of the Sevenoaks 600 vision .
